NAWABSHAH, Aug 12: Witnesses on Saturday recorded statements before the Sakrand judicial magistrate in a staged encounter case in which Rasool Bux Brohi was killed by police personnel of the Lyari Task Force.

Saheb Khan Chandio, a passenger of the bus from which Rasool Bux was picked up, Nazar alias Nazroo Khaskheli, who accompanied the deceased, bus driver and conductor recorded statements in the court.

Saheb Khan said that he was not travelling in the bus from which Rasool Bux was reportedly detained.

Nazroo Khaskheli said that he was unaware of any such incident.

Bus driver Azeem and conductor Ali Hassan said that they did not meet any police team on July 10, and no such incident had occurred during their travel.

When judicial magistrate Suhail Akhtar Mangi asked Lal Bibi, the widow of deceased Rasool Bux Brohi, that was she feeling insecure and had she any objection to statements, she surprisingly replied in negative.

Accused Chaudhry Aslam Khan, inspector Nasirul Hassan, sub-inspector Mir Farosh and Jamil Qureshi also attended the court without handcuffs.

Hot words were exchanged between journalists and security guards of the suspended SP who tried to stop them for covering proceedings.

Ms Pathani and Mohammad Ismail, mother and father of the deceased, told reporters that suspended SP Chaudhry Aslam and others came to them with Holy Book and asked for forgiveness after which they had forgiven them.
